Enclosed Coil Uncoiling, Leveling, Feeding, Cutting and Offloading

The Dato FC-BS is an enclosed coil-fed fiber laser cutting production line designed for automated thin sheet metal processing. It integrates coil uncoiling, leveling, servo feeding, enclosed fiber laser cutting, and offloading into one continuous workflow.

Compared with a standard sheet laser cutting machine, the FC-BS reduces manual loading and supports continuous cutting from coil material. Compared with the open FC-B coil-fed line, the enclosed structure helps improve operator safety, smoke control, and workshop cleanliness.

Machine Features

Heavy-Duty-Uncoiler

Efficient Uncoiling

The uncoiling system feeds coil material continuously into the leveling and cutting line. It helps reduce manual handling and supports stable batch production from metal coils.

Precision-Leveling-Machine

Automatic Leveling

The leveling system helps flatten coil material before cutting. This improves feeding stability and cutting quality for 2-4 mm sheet metal coil processing.

Precise-control

Precise CNC Control

The CNC control system coordinates uncoiling, leveling, feeding, and laser cutting to maintain stable production. It helps ensure repeatable cutting dimensions during long-term batch processing.

FC-BS Enclosed Coil-Fed Fiber Laser Cutting Line FAQs

What is the FC-BS enclosed coil-fed fiber laser cutting line used for?

The FC-BS is used for automated cutting of sheet metal coils. It integrates uncoiling, leveling, feeding, enclosed fiber laser cutting, and offloading into one continuous production line.

What is the difference between FC-BS and FC-B?


FC-B is an open coil-fed laser cutting line, while FC-BS uses an enclosed cutting area. The enclosed structure helps improve operation safety, smoke control, and workshop cleanliness.


What materials can the FC-BS process?

The FC-BS can process carbon steel, stainless steel, aluminum, galvanized sheet, and other suitable sheet metal coils. Material compatibility depends on laser power, coil thickness, gas type, and cutting requirements.

What sheet thickness is suitable for the FC-BS?

The current FC-BS configuration is designed for 2-4 mm sheet metal coil processing. Please confirm your material and thickness with Dato before choosing the production line.

What coil width can the FC-BS support?

The FC-BS supports material width up to 2000 mm, based on the current page specification. Final configuration should be confirmed according to your coil width, coil weight, inner diameter, outer diameter, and workshop layout.

What laser power does the FC-BS use?

The current page lists 6000W laser power. Dato can confirm whether other power options are available based on your material, thickness, cutting speed, and production requirements.

Can the FC-BS improve material utilization?

Yes. The coil-fed workflow can improve material utilization through continuous feeding and nesting from coil material. Actual material savings depend on part shape, nesting layout, and production plan.
